Admissions Advisor (Inbound)
Remote
Job Summary
Respond promptly to inbound inquiries from families, often within minutes of submission. Conduct warm, consultative calls to understand student grade levels, academic profiles, goals, and current admissions stages. Ask discovery questions to determine family needs, discuss U.S. college admissions topics including testing and timelines, and build trust through professional communication. Qualify strong-fit families and schedule them for consultations with appropriate counselors. Maintain detailed notes on conversations and next steps in the CRM. Follow up with families who do not answer the initial call and ensure qualified leads receive timely outreach. Work from 9:00 AM to 6:00 PM PT with occasional evening calls as needed.
Required Qualifications
- 5+ years of professional experience
- significant experience in phone-based roles
- Strong working knowledge of the U.S. high school and college admissions process
- Ability to comfortably discuss a student's academic profile, including grade level, coursework, transcript strength, testing, and admissions timelines
- Fluent, clear, and highly professional spoken English with a warm and confident phone presence
- Strong listening, discovery, and qualification skills
- Comfortable having consultative conversations with parents and guiding them toward the appropriate next step
- Strong organizational skills and attention to detail when documenting calls and managing follow-ups
- Comfortable working from 9:00 AM to 6:00 PM PT, with occasional evening calls as needed
- Ability to work independently while collaborating closely with admissions counselors and the broader team
Desired Qualifications
- Background in college admissions consulting, educational technology (EdTech), or a U.S. college/university
- Previous experience in an inbound sales, admissions, enrollment, or high-volume call environment
- Experience working with CRM or lead management systems
- Experience qualifying prospective families and scheduling consultations or appointments
